What happened
Israel’s women’s goalball team lost 12-4 to China in the World Championships final and finished second. Their run secured Israel’s first qualification for the Los Angeles 2028 Paralympics. The men’s team made its World Championships debut and placed 15th.
- 01Israel’s women lost 12-4 to China in the World Championships final.
- 02Reaching the final secured Israel’s first Los Angeles 2028 Paralympic berth.
- 03Captain Lihiya Ben David said the team was “full of happiness and pride.”
- 04Israel’s men debuted at the Worlds and finished 15th.
- 05The men ended with a 9-4 win over Egypt.
